OREANDA-NEWS. Marat Gareev has been appointed Head of Medium Enterprises at Otkritie FC Bank. In this capacity, Marat will be responsible for expanding the client base and further developing customer services for mid-sized corporates (with annual turnover between RUB 300 million and RUB 3 billion) in all regions where the bank currently operates.  “Developing our relations with medium-sized businesses is a key part of our strategy,” stated   Senior Vice President of Otkritie FC Bank Gennady Zhuzhlev. “We see a large potential for growth in this segment, and I am confident that Marat, with his experience in the Russian corporate banking sphere, will be able to effectively work to meet our goals in this business area.”  Marat Gareev brings two decades of experience in the Russian banking services market.  Marat joins Otkritie FC from Alfa Bank, where he headed the regional centre within the bank’s corporate and investment division.  Marat began his career in the financial sector in 1996 with UralSib, where he held various positions through 2004. Marat Gareev graduated from Ufa State Petroleum Technological University in 1996, specialising in Economics and Management of Enterprises in the Fuel and Energy Industry. In 2004, Marat completed graduate studies at the Finance Academy under the Government of the Russian Federation. In his new capacity as Head of Medium Enterprises, Marat has replaced Natalia Matyunina, who has decided to continue her career with another organisation.
